Industrial boilers are manufactured for all types of fuel :solids,liquids & gas.

The more the options are introduced for burning the higher the cost and the complex the firing-system.

Be specific to detail your application as to available of fuel, capacity of boiler and operating pressure.

Boiler is a hardware available in thousands. Have you carried out your research in bio-fuels available? their supply, price factor etc? Suggest you first undertake this to come to your selection of the right type biofuel on which the boiler to be designed.
